1. What Is An OBD2 Scanner Code Reader And Why Do I Need One?

An OBD2 scanner code reader is a device that connects to your car’s On-Board Diagnostics (OBD) system to read diagnostic trouble codes (DTCs), and you need one to quickly identify and troubleshoot issues with your vehicle, saving time and money on unnecessary mechanic visits. These tools help diagnose everything from engine problems to transmission issues, providing valuable insights for both DIY enthusiasts and professional technicians.

  • Early Detection: Identifies problems before they escalate into costly repairs.
  • Cost Savings: Reduces the need for expensive diagnostic services at repair shops.
  • Informed Decisions: Provides data to make informed decisions about vehicle maintenance and repairs.

4. How Do I Use An OBD2 Scanner Code Reader To Diagnose Car Problems?

To use an OBD2 scanner code reader, plug it into your car’s OBD2 port, turn on the ignition, and follow the scanner’s instructions to read and interpret diagnostic trouble codes (DTCs), which will help you pinpoint the source of the problem.

Step-by-Step Guide:

  1. Locate the OBD2 Port: Usually found under the dashboard on the driver’s side.
  2. Plug in the Scanner: Connect the OBD2 scanner to the port.
  3. Turn on the Ignition: Turn the key to the “on” position without starting the engine.
  4. Read the Codes: Follow the scanner’s prompts to read any stored diagnostic trouble codes (DTCs).
  5. Interpret the Codes: Use a code database or online resource to understand the meaning of each DTC.
  6. Clear the Codes (Optional): After addressing the issue, you can clear the codes to reset the check engine light.

5. What Are The Most Common Diagnostic Trouble Codes (DTCs) And Their Meanings?

Common Diagnostic Trouble Codes (DTCs) include P0300 (Random/Multiple Cylinder Misfire), P0171 (System Too Lean), and P0420 (Catalyst System Efficiency Below Threshold), each indicating specific issues that need attention.

DTC Code Description Possible Causes
P0300 Random/Multiple Cylinder Misfire Faulty spark plugs, ignition coils, fuel injectors, vacuum leaks
P0171 System Too Lean (Bank 1) Vacuum leaks, faulty O2 sensor, low fuel pressure
P0420 Catalyst System Efficiency Below Threshold Faulty catalytic converter, O2 sensors, exhaust leaks
P0101 Mass Air Flow (MAF) Sensor Circuit Range Dirty or faulty MAF sensor, vacuum leaks
P0301 Cylinder 1 Misfire Detected Faulty spark plug, ignition coil, fuel injector, low compression

11. How Do I Interpret Live Data From An OBD2 Scanner Code Reader?

Interpreting live data from an OBD2 scanner code reader involves monitoring parameters such as engine RPM, coolant temperature, and O2 sensor readings to identify abnormalities and diagnose performance issues.

Key Parameters to Monitor:

  • Engine RPM: Indicates the engine’s rotational speed.
  • Coolant Temperature: Monitors the engine’s operating temperature.
  • O2 Sensor Readings: Measures the oxygen content in the exhaust to assess fuel mixture.
  • Fuel Trims: Indicates how the engine is adjusting the fuel mixture.
  • Mass Air Flow (MAF): Measures the amount of air entering the engine.

12. What Is Freeze Frame Data And How Can It Help With Diagnostics?

Freeze frame data captures a snapshot of sensor values when a diagnostic trouble code (DTC) is triggered, providing valuable information about the conditions that led to the fault and aiding in accurate diagnostics.

Benefits of Freeze Frame Data:

  • Snapshot of Sensor Values: Captures data at the moment a DTC is triggered.
  • Helps Identify Root Cause: Provides clues about the conditions that led to the fault.
  • Aids in Accurate Diagnostics: Helps pinpoint the source of the problem.

13. How Do I Clear Diagnostic Trouble Codes (DTCs) With An OBD2 Scanner Code Reader?

To clear Diagnostic Trouble Codes (DTCs) with an OBD2 scanner code reader, follow the scanner’s instructions to erase the codes after addressing the underlying issue, which will reset the check engine light.

Step-by-Step Guide:

  1. Connect the Scanner: Plug the OBD2 scanner into the OBD2 port.
  2. Turn on the Ignition: Turn the key to the “on” position without starting the engine.
  3. Navigate to Code Clearing: Follow the scanner’s prompts to find the code clearing function.
  4. Clear the Codes: Select the option to clear the stored DTCs.
  5. Verify the Codes Are Cleared: Confirm that the check engine light has turned off and the codes are no longer present.

Important Note: Clearing DTCs without addressing the underlying issue will only temporarily turn off the check engine light. The light will reappear if the problem persists.

14. Can An OBD2 Scanner Code Reader Perform Advanced Functions Like Bi-Directional Control?

Some advanced OBD2 scanner code readers can perform bi-directional control, allowing you to command specific vehicle components to activate or deactivate, which helps diagnose issues with actuators, solenoids, and other control systems.

Benefits of Bi-Directional Control:

  • Component Testing: Allows you to test individual components by commanding them to activate or deactivate.
  • System Verification: Helps verify the proper operation of control systems.
  • Accurate Diagnostics: Provides more precise diagnostics compared to simple code reading.

16. What Are The Limitations Of Using An OBD2 Scanner Code Reader?

Limitations of using an OBD2 scanner code reader include the inability to diagnose all vehicle problems, dependence on accurate code definitions, and the need for technical knowledge to interpret data effectively, so consider these factors when relying on an OBD2 scanner for diagnostics.

Common Limitations:

  • Cannot Diagnose All Problems: Some issues may not trigger a DTC or be detectable by the scanner.
  • Dependence on Accurate Code Definitions: The accuracy of the diagnosis depends on the accuracy of the code definitions.
  • Need for Technical Knowledge: Interpreting the data and performing accurate diagnostics requires technical knowledge and experience.
  • Limited Coverage: Some scanners may not support all vehicle makes and models or all diagnostic functions.

2. Are OBD2 scanners compatible with all car makes and models?

While OBD2 scanners are designed to be universally compatible with all cars and light trucks sold in the United States after 1996, compatibility can vary. It’s essential to check the scanner’s specifications to ensure it supports your specific vehicle.

3. Can an OBD2 scanner turn off the check engine light permanently?

An OBD2 scanner can turn off the check engine light after you’ve addressed the underlying issue causing the light to illuminate. However, if the problem persists, the light will reappear.
